PhotographyCorner.com Announces Contest Corner Challenge #56: Overflowing

Contest Corner Challenge #56: Overflowing is the Latest Contest Challenge at www.PhotographyCorner.com, which asks photographers to photograph something that is overflowing.

Barrie, Ontario, Canada, September 11, 2008 --(PR.com)-- Photography Corner (www.PhotographyCorner.com) has announced a new Contest Corner Challenge open to all members of the popular photography community. The latest challenge asks photographers to photograph something that is overflowing (a coffee cup, a street, a bag of leaves, a garbage can, etc). A challenge winner will be chosen after a five-day voting period by PhotographyCorner.com members when the contest ends on September 22nd, 2008. The site began offering Contest Corner Challenges in July 2004, and new challenges are issued approximately eighteen times per year. The prize for the current challenge is a website design and hosting package provided by XLD Studios.

Photographers who join PhotographyCorner.com have the ability to enter one photograph for each of the Contest Corner Challenges. In an effort to make the contests fair for all members, only photographs taken during the time of the contest can be entered, and only minor post-production photo manipulation can be used.

Contest Corner Challenges at www.PhotographyCorner.com are issued to site members in the community’s forum. Only Premiere Members of Photography Corner (requires a yearly or lifetime subscription) are eligible to win some of the prizes, but all members of the site are always invited to submit photographs to the contest and to participate in the five-day voting window to vote on contest winners and discuss submissions after they have all been received.

About www.PhotographyCorner.com

PhotographyCorner.com is a leading portal for photographers, which includes member-written articles, tutorials, forums, a photography directory and projects. The site runs a monthly Photograph of the Month contests and eighteen yearly Contest Corner Challenges, as well as providing an area of the site for photographers to receive constructive criticism of their work in the Critiques Corner. As a further resource to photographers, PhotographyCorner.com provides photography news, camera reviews, and information on photography contests and events throughout the world. PhotographyCorner.com was launched in March 2004.
